Regulations for the promotion of high-performance athletes training are ready

Through Decree 1052 of 2022, the Ministry of Sports issued regulations with the purpose of preparing high performance athletes -athletes and parathletes- for the country's sports reserve; as well as the articulation of the National Sports System for the development of the process of formation, search, identification, selection and training of minors and young people with skills, talent and potential to become performance or high-performance athletes of the country. The decree also establishes rules for the support to women's performance and high-performance sports, the strategy for the conformation of the national Olympic, Paralympic and deaf-Olympic teams, the recognition of performance and high-performance results, the sports retirement stage, sports glories, and institutional articulation.

 


 

New rules on youth employment in Colombia's public sector

The Congress of the Republic issued Law 2214 of June 22, 2022, through which Article 196 of Law 1955 of 2019 regarding the generation of employment for the young population of the country is regulated, whose objective is the implementation of public sector measures tending to the elimination of employability barriers for people between 18 and 28 years old and the expansion of the supply of jobs in state entities at the national level. Public entities must, within 12 months following the entry into force of the law, adapt their manuals of functions and labor competencies with the corresponding equivalences, enabling the appointment of these young people, as long as they meet other requirements established for the corresponding position. 

 


 

Modifications to Safety Regulations for Underground Mining labor

Through Decree 944 of 2022, issued by the Ministries of Health and Social Protection, Labor and Mines and Energy, the Safety Regulations for Underground Mining labors, applicable to natural and legal persons developing underground mining labors in the Colombian territory, were modified. Likewise, special obligations were included for the mining employers, to provide training in underground mining labors to employees under their charge through institutions such as SENA, technical institutions, technological and universities duly approved by the Ministry of National Education, institutions for work and human development and family compensation funds.

 


 

José Antonio Ocampo appointed as Petro's Finance Minister

Gustavo Petro appointed José Antonio Ocampo as Minister of Finance. Ocampo is a sociologist and political scientist and is one of the country's most prominent economists. He was Minister of Agriculture and Rural Development, Director of the National Planning Department, Minister of Finance and Public Credit, Member of the Board of Directors of Banco de la República, Executive Director of ECLAC and Assistant Secretary General of the United Nations. Multiple sectors have expressed their support for Ocampo's appointment due to his moderate stance and technical capacity.
